项目摘要
The purpose of the present study was to investigate the marginal fracture of composite inlay with each of three marginal forms-butt joint, straight bevel and round bevel, under simulated occlusal force and to estimate their clinical performance.Six class 1 cavities with each marginal form were prepared on the surfaces of extracted incisors. Indirect composite inlay was inserted into the cavity with a dual-cured resin cement. Half of the restored teeth was subjected to 5000 thermocyclings between 4 and 60゚C and the other half was stored in water. After all teeth were subjected to the load cycling test designed for a stainless rod (weight : lkg) to fall repeatedly from the height of 1.5cm at 125 times/min, they were immersed in fuchsin solution for 24 hours. Degree of marginal fracture and leakage were observed. The teeth restored by direct composite filling technique were also tested as control. In clinic, carious molar teeth were restored with composite inlay with each marginal form. Clinical-estimation was performed at 0, 3 and 6 months later, using a USPHS criteria. The marginal integrity of the restorations was also observed by SEM.Results were as follows ;1. The frequency of marginal fracture of indirect composite inlay was lower than that of direct composite restorations. However it was increased by thermocycling, while in direct composite restoration there was no effect of thermocycling.2. In indirect composite inlay without thermocycling, the order of the frequency of fracture was straight bevel>round bevel>butt joint.3. The order of the degree of marginal leakage around both restorations after thermocycling was butt joint>round bevel>straight bevel.4. Marginal leakage around indirect composite inlay was remarkably increased by thermocycling.5. In clinical estimation, no marginal fracture around composite inlay was observed at the period of 6 months.
